    No, I would actually say it's the opposite - not drinking enough water usually leads to water retention, which causes weight gain or no loss.

    Now, if you chugged 8 glasses of water and then weighed yourself, of course you would weigh more, but I'm assuming that's not what they meant.

    Water is actually an excellent aid to weight loss. Most people don't get enough water, so don't worry about drinking too much unless your salt intake is on the low side (which most people's aren't).
